How Many Types of Mackerel Fish Are There?

There are about 30 recognized species of mackerel fish globally. These species are part of the Scombridae family, which includes both mackerels and tunas. The most well-known types of mackerel include the Atlantic mackerel, Spanish mackerel, and King mackerel. Each type is characterized by distinct physical features, habitats, and behaviors.

The Atlantic mackerel (Scomber scombrus) is common in the North Atlantic. It has a streamlined body and greenish-blue stripes on its back. The Spanish mackerel (Scomberomorus maculatus) is found in warmer waters, typically around the Gulf of Mexico and the Caribbean. It has a more elongated shape and distinctive spots along its body. The King mackerel (Scomberomorus cavalla) is larger and sought after for sport fishing, prevalent along the eastern coast of the United States.

Factors such as water temperature, salinity, and availability of prey can influence the distribution and behavior of mackerel species. For example, Atlantic mackerel thrive in cooler waters, while Spanish mackerel prefer warmer environments. Overfishing has also impacted populations, leading to conservation measures in some areas.

What Distinguishes Each Mackerel Species?

Various species of mackerel can be distinguished by their size, habitat, appearance, and behavior. These characteristics vary widely across different mackerel species, making each one unique.

  1. Atlantic Mackerel:
    Atlantic mackerel belongs to the family Scombridae and is known for its distinctive greenish-blue coloration and vertical stripes. It typically grows up to 18 inches in length. This species inhabits the North Atlantic, particularly near continental shelves. It plays a significant role in the fishing industry, as per NOAA Fisheries, which notes an average annual catch of around 100 million pounds.

  2. Spanish Mackerel:
    Spanish mackerel features a well-defined, elongated body and can grow up to 30 inches long. The species has a characteristic spotted pattern on its back. Traditionally found in warm, coastal waters of the Western Atlantic, it is popular in recreational fishing. According to a study by Helfman et al. (2009), its population has shown fluctuations, influenced by environmental factors and fishing pressures.

  3. King Mackerel:
    King mackerel, known for its large size (up to 67 inches) and powerful swimming capability, is distinguished by its long, slender body. This species prefers warmer waters and migrates seasonally along the Atlantic coast. It is a sought-after target in sport fishing due to its fighting ability. According to the Florida Fish and Wildlife Conservation Commission, fish averaging 10 to 30 pounds are commonly caught, but larger specimens exist.

  4. Chub Mackerel:
    Chub mackerel features a shorter, more robust body compared to its relatives and can reach lengths of up to 24 inches. This species thrives in the temperate waters of both the Atlantic and Pacific Oceans. It has culinary significance in many cultures, often consumed fresh or preserved. The Fisheries and Aquaculture Department of the United Nations estimates chub mackerel’s global catch at over 400,000 tons per year.

  5. Pacific Mackerel:
    Pacific mackerel is closely related to the chub mackerel but is typically found in the Pacific Ocean. This species exhibits a streamlined body and maintains a length of around 18 inches. It is known for its quick swimming pace. While its population status varies, local fisheries in Asia regard it as an important food source, contributing significantly to regional diets.

  6. Horse Mackerel:
    Horse mackerel, also known as Trachurus, is characterized by a robust body with a forked tail. This species can grow to 20 inches in length and is often found in schools in deeper waters. It is valuable for commercial fisheries and is frequently caught for both food and bait. Recent assessments indicate that horse mackerel stocks are healthy, but regional overfishing can still pose risks.

Where Do Different Types of Mackerel Fish Live?

Different types of mackerel fish live in various oceanic environments. Atlantic mackerel inhabit the North Atlantic Ocean. They prefer cooler waters and often migrate. Pacific mackerel are found along the Pacific coast of North America, where they thrive in both coastal and pelagic (open sea) zones. Spanish mackerel dwell in warmer waters, particularly around the Gulf of Mexico and the southeastern Atlantic coast. Finally, king mackerel, also known as kingfish, prefer offshore warmer waters of the Atlantic Ocean and the Gulf of Mexico. Each species adapts to specific habitats based on temperature and food availability.

  1. Atlantic Mackerel:
    The Atlantic Mackerel, scientifically known as Scomber scombrus, inhabits the waters of the North Atlantic Ocean. It prefers temperate waters and is commonly found near continental shelves. This species often migrates between deep and shallow waters to access food sources. Research by the National Oceanic and Atmospheric Administration (NOAA) states that this fish typically thrives in waters ranging from 10°C to 20°C.

  2. Spanish Mackerel:
    The Spanish Mackerel, or Scomberomorus maculatus, is found along the coasts of the western Atlantic Ocean and the Gulf of Mexico. It prefers warmer waters, usually between 18°C and 30°C, often residing in shallow coastal areas with sand or grass beds. According to a study by the Gulf States Marine Fisheries Commission, this species often migrates depending on the seasonal availability of prey.

  3. Chub Mackerel:
    Chub Mackerel, referred to as Scomber japonicus, inhabits the Pacific Ocean. This species typically occupies coastal waters and pelagic zones. It is known for its wide distribution, present from temperate to tropical regions. The Food and Agriculture Organization (FAO) reports that Chub Mackerel often forms schools, moving together in search of food.

  4. Pacific Mackerel:
    The Pacific Mackerel, known as Scomber japonicus, enjoys a widespread range in the eastern Pacific Ocean, particularly off the coasts of North America and Asia. It thrives in deeply productive waters. Research conducted by the California Department of Fish and Wildlife indicates that Pacific Mackerel prefer waters between 13°C and 22°C and demonstrate similar schooling behavior to Chub Mackerel.

  5. Horse Mackerel:
    Horse Mackerel, or Trachurus trachurus, is found in Atlantic waters and has a preference for both continental shelves and deeper oceanic waters. This species is known for its resilience and can adapt to varying salinity and temperature. A study by the International Council for the Exploration of the Sea (ICES) highlights that they often gather in large schools, aiding in efficient feeding and predator avoidance.

  6. Indian Mackerel:
    The Indian Mackerel, or Rastrelliger kanagurta, thrives in the warm, coastal waters of the Indian Ocean. This species is often found in shallow waters close to coral reefs and mangroves. Research from the Asian Fisheries Society reported that this species’ habitat is integral to its life cycle, as it relies on these environments for breeding and feeding.

How Do Environmental Conditions Affect Mackerel Habitats?

Environmental conditions significantly affect mackerel habitats through factors such as water temperature, salinity, oxygen levels, and nutrient availability. These elements influence mackerel distribution, growth, reproduction, and overall health.

  • Water temperature: Mackerel prefer warm waters, typically between 10°C and 25°C. An increase in temperature can enhance metabolism, leading to faster growth. Conversely, temperatures that are too high can stress fish and reduce their survival rates (Morris et al., 2012).

  • Salinity: Mackerel thrive in a salinity range of about 30 to 37 parts per thousand (ppt). Changes in salinity can alter mackerel behavior and distribution. Reduced salinity from freshwater input can lead to a decline in mackerel populations in estuarine areas (Smith et al., 2015).

  • Oxygen levels: Mackerel require well-oxygenated waters for optimal health. Low oxygen levels, often resulting from eutrophication (nutrient pollution), can create hypoxic conditions that suffocate fish and lead to mass die-offs (Pauly et al., 2013).

  • Nutrient availability: The presence of nutrients like phosphates and nitrates influences plankton growth, which is the primary food source for mackerel. Increased nutrient levels can promote algal blooms, but excessive blooms can produce toxins that harm mackerel (Duarte et al., 2010).

These environmental conditions collectively shape the ecological niches where mackerel are found, thereby directly impacting their survival and productivity within marine ecosystems.

How Do Different Species of Mackerel Compare in Flavor?

Different species of mackerel vary in flavor due to differences in fat content, texture, and habitat.

The flavor profiles of mackerel are influenced by several factors:

  • Fat content: Species like the Atlantic mackerel (Scomber scombrus) typically have a high oil content. This contributes to a rich, buttery flavor. In contrast, the Spanish mackerel (Scomberomorus maculatus) has a slightly lower fat content, resulting in a milder taste. Research conducted by the Seafood Laboratory indicates that fish with higher fat levels generally deliver a more pronounced umami flavor (Smith et al., 2020).

  • Texture: The texture varies between species. The king mackerel (Scomberomorus cavalla) has a dense and firm flesh. This makes it ideal for grilling and barbecuing. The Atlantic mackerel, however, is softer and flakier. Its flesh is best suited for smoking and broiling, which enhances its flavor profile. A study from the Journal of Food Science emphasizes how the texture can significantly impact consumer preference (Jones & Roberts, 2019).

  • Habitat: The living environment affects the flavor due to differences in diet and water temperature. Mackerel found in colder waters tend to have more pronounced flavors because of their diet, which is richer in nutrients. This nutritional intake results in fish that taste stronger and more flavorful. According to a 2021 report from Marine Research, habitats with diverse feeding opportunities lead to better flavor development in fish populations.

  • Cooking methods: Different cooking methods can also emphasize various flavor aspects. Grilling or smoking mackerel can enhance its rich taste, while poaching will produce a milder flavor.

These variations among species are important considerations for chefs and consumers when selecting mackerel for culinary uses. The distinct flavors can complement various dishes, making them versatile in many cuisines.

How Is Mackerel Fish Caught and Managed?

Mackerel fish are caught using several methods, which include purse seine netting, trolling, and longlining. Purse seine netting involves encircling schools of mackerel with a large wall of netting. Fishermen then draw the net closed at the bottom, trapping the fish inside. Trolling employs lines with lures that mimic smaller fish. Boats tow these lines at various speeds, enticing mackerel to bite. Longlining involves setting a long line with baited hooks at intervals. This method can target specific sizes and species of mackerel.

Fishery management organizations oversee mackerel populations to ensure sustainable practices. They use quotas to limit the number of fish caught and maintain population levels. Scientists monitor mackerel stocks through assessments of population size, growth rates, and reproduction. These assessments help determine catch limits and fishing seasons. Effective management practices aim to balance fishery needs with ecological health, supporting both the fishing industry and marine ecosystems.   1. Overfishing: Overfishing creates significant concerns for mackerel fisheries. This occurs when fish are captured at a rate faster than they can reproduce. According to the Food and Agriculture Organization (FAO), many mackerel stocks are overfished, leading to population declines. For instance, recent assessments showed that North Atlantic mackerel populations are at risk due to unsustainable fishing practices. Overfishing poses risks to the marine food chain and sustainability of fisheries.

  2. Ecological Balance: Ecological balance is crucial in maintaining a healthy marine environment. Mackerel play a vital role in the diet of larger predators, such as sharks and tuna, and are an essential part of the ocean food web. The decline in mackerel populations can disrupt these ecosystems. Reports, such as those from the International Council for the Exploration of the Sea (ICES), highlight the ripple effects on biodiversity when critical species like mackerel are overexploited.

  3. Economic Viability: Economic viability concerns the sustainability of mackerel fisheries long-term and their economic impacts on coastal communities. Many communities depend on mackerel fishing for their livelihoods. A decline in mackerel stocks can lead to job loss and decreased income in these regions. For example, a study by the Pew Environment Group in 2018 noted that declining fish stocks directly correlate with increased poverty levels in fishing-dependent communities.

  4. Regulatory Framework: The regulatory framework plays a significant role in managing mackerel fisheries. Effective policies are essential to ensure sustainable practices. The lack of stringent regulations leads to illegal, unreported, and unregulated (IUU) fishing, further threatening mackerel populations. The European Union has implemented quotas and management plans, but enforcement and compliance remain challenges.

  5. Consumer Awareness: Consumer awareness impacts the sustainability of mackerel fisheries. Increased demand for sustainable seafood drives markets toward responsible fishing practices. Programs like the Marine Stewardship Council (MSC) encourage consumers to choose sustainably sourced seafood, including mackerel. As awareness grows, consumers can influence fisheries to adopt more sustainable practices.
